Welcome to Kōchi, Japan: A Jewel of the Shikoku Island!

G’day cruisers! Get ready to discover Kōchi, a charming city located on the southern coast of Shikoku Island, where nature, history, and vibrant culture come together beautifully. Kōchi is famous for its scenic coastal views, delicious cuisine, including fresh seafood and local specialties, and the breathtaking surrounding landscapes. Fun fact: Kōchi is renowned for the Yosakoi Matsuri, a lively dance festival held every August that attracts participants from all over Japan! Visiting Kōchi on a cruise offers you a convenient way to explore this scenic region while enjoying all the luxuries of life at sea.

Activities and Sights to Enjoy in Kōchi, Japan

When your cruise ship docks in Kōchi, there are many engaging activities and sights to explore within close proximity:

  • Visit Kōchi Castle: Step into history by exploring this stunning hilltop castle built in the 17th century. With its beautifully preserved architecture and the surrounding park, it’s the perfect spot to capture picturesque views of the city.
  • Explore the Market at Hirome Street: Experience local culture at Hirome Street, a vibrant market filled with food stalls and shops. Sample local dishes such as Kōchi-style sashimi and relax with a refreshing drink at one of the many beer gardens.
  • Stroll through Katsurahama Beach: Take a relaxing walk along this renowned beach known for its natural beauty. Visit the statue of the famous samurai Sakamoto Ryōma, who played a vital role in the country’s history.
  • Experience the Yosakoi Dance: If you’re lucky enough to visit in August, don’t miss the Yosakoi Matsuri festival. You might catch amazing dance performances that showcase vibrant costumes and lively music!
  • Discover the Kōchi Ryu Shinto Shrine: A visit to this serene shrine will introduce you to Shinto architecture amidst the backdrop of lush greenery. It’s a peaceful retreat perfect for reflection.

Best Times to Visit Kōchi, Japan on a Cruise

  • Summer (June, July, August): Expect warm temperatures ranging from 25°C to 35°C, perfect for outdoor exploration, though humidity can be high during this time.
  • Autumn (September, October, November): Temperatures cool down to around 15°C to 25°C. The autumn foliage makes for beautiful scenery, which enhances your sightseeing experience.
  • Winter (December, January, February): With cooler temperatures between 5°C and 15°C, winter is a quieter time for travel, ideal for enjoying the peaceful atmosphere as well as experiencing seasonal festivals.
  • Spring (March, April, May): Spring brings mild temperatures from 10°C to 20°C, along with cherry blossoms that create stunning visual displays around parks and gardens. A wonderful time for sightseeing!

Frequently Asked Questions about Kōchi, Japan

What is the typical cost of a cruise?

A one-week cruise visiting Kōchi generally averages around $1,200 for regular options, while luxury cruises can range from $3,500 to $8,000 depending on the cruise line and accommodations.

What should I expect for the costs of food and beverages?

Dining in Kōchi typically ranges from ¥1,000 to ¥3,000 for meals at local restaurants, while beverages might cost around ¥300 to ¥1,000.

What are some of the dining and shopping possibilities to know about?

Kōchi is well-known for its fresh seafood and local delicacies. Be sure to try the Kōchi’s famous katsuo (bonito fish) sashimi and explore local markets for crafts and souvenirs!

What are transportation options?

Transportation options in Kōchi include local buses, taxis, and rental bicycles. The city has good public transit, and many attractions are easily accessible.

What should I know about the local currency and making payments?

The local currency is the Japanese Yen (¥). Credit and debit cards are increasingly accepted, but having cash is advisable, especially for smaller shops and restaurants.

What are safety and health tips to be aware of?

Kōchi is generally safe for tourists. Stay vigilant in crowded areas, and always take common-sense precautions to protect your belongings.

What are some helpful language or cultural tips?

Japanese is the primary language spoken in Kōchi, but many locals in tourist areas can communicate in basic English. Familiarizing yourself with a few key Japanese phrases can always enhance your experience!
